The % is based on number of files. Not on the size of the files. At least from what I’ve read.
A 100 file update that’s 10 GB will be 20% done when it hits file 20 not when it’s finished 2 GB.
There is something wrong, but it’s a user interface issue. At this point I’m at 83% and 1036 MB. Does the percentage done refer to the number of files instead of the total data size? If so I’d say that’s a confusing UI element. No one cares how many files there. All that matters to the download time is the total size of the data.
